Texas HB1908 amends the Penal Code to redefine certain offenses related to carrying a handgun while intoxicated and by license holders in alcohol-serving locations. It specifies that offenses committed on or after the effective date of the Act are subject to the new law, while those committed before the effective date follow existing law. The Act also introduces a defense for license holders who are not intoxicated while carrying a handgun in specified locations. The changes take effect on September 1, 2025.
